Greece Two-Day Old Government Dissolved, Fresh Elections On June 17 - Wall Street Journal

USA TODAY

Greece Two-Day Old Government Dissolved, Fresh Elections On June 17
Wall Street Journal
May 6 elections' result denied an outright majority in parliament to Greece's two battered establishment parties, conservative New Democracy and socialist Pasok, which have been seeking to implement austerity policies.
